WebOpening QuicKey displays a list of the last 50 tabs you've visited, in order of recency. Click a tab to switch to it, or use one of the keyboard shortcuts below to navigate the recently used tab history: To switch between the two most recent tabs: Press alt Z ( ctrl Z on macOS). OR. Web14 feb. 2024 · One of the best Taskbar shortcuts allows you to open any of the first ten programs pinned to your Taskbar. To launch an app, just press Win + 1 through Win + 0 to open the program in that position. So, Win + 1 opens the leftmost icon on your Taskbar, while Win + 0 opens the tenth item. Web3 nov. 2024 · It is also possible to setup a custom keyboard shortcut to open calculator app. Go to “C:\Windows\System32” and locate “calc.exe” file. Right click on the file and select “Properties”. If you have desktop shortcut, you can also right click on it and choose “Properties”. Assign the “Shortcut key” under “Shortcut” tab.
